Trump Sets 20‑Year Deadline to Limit Iran’s Nuclear Program

|Washington, D.C., Iran|1 independent sources

Published by WarSignal Editorial · Last updated

Former U.S. President Donald Trump announced a 20‑year timeline for curbing Iran’s nuclear activities, stating that the United States will take action if the program continues unchecked.

The statement, made in Washington, emphasized that the U.S. would impose limits on Iran’s nuclear program within two decades, citing concerns over proliferation and regional security.

Trump’s remarks come amid ongoing diplomatic efforts to revive the 2015 nuclear deal and address Iran’s ballistic missile program, though no specific enforcement measures were detailed in the announcement.
